about 3 hours ago

Machine Learning Engineer II - Behavioral Security Products

Remote - UK
full-timemid RemoteCybersecurity

Tech Stack

Description

You will join the Account Takeover Detection team to build ML systems that detect malicious activity and protect customers from account takeovers. You'll define technical goals, maintain production models, and ensure operational excellence while leveraging cutting-edge machine learning technologies.

Requirements

  • 3+ years proven experience as a Machine Learning Engineer or similar role in a commercial environment.
  • Knowledge of machine learning algorithms, statistics, and predictive modeling.
  • Proficiency with Python and ML toolkits like pandas, scikit-learn, and optionally PyTorch/TensorFlow.
  • Awareness of MLOps and productionization of ML models best practices.
  • Familiarity with building data and metric generation pipelines using tools like SQL or Spark.
  • Ability to communicate technical ideas in a clear, non-technical manner.

Responsibilities

  • Contribute to development of machine learning algorithms and models for behavioral modeling and cybersecurity attack detection.
  • Work with cross-functional teams to understand requirements and translate them into effective ML solutions.
  • Conduct exploratory data analysis, feature engineering, model development and evaluation.
  • Work with infrastructure product engineers to productionize models and new ML-based features.
  • Monitor and improve production models through feature engineering, rules, and ML modeling.
  • Participate in code reviews to ensure quality and maintainability of ML systems.
  • Stay updated on latest research in ML, data science, and AI.
  • Adopt and contribute to development of ML best practices within the organization.
0 views 0 saves 0 applications